Germinal
Relating to the initial stage of development after fertilization, in which cell division and implantation in the uterus occur.
Embryonic
Pertaining to the initial stages of development after fertilization and before fetal stage in organisms.
Fetal Periods
Stages of human development in the womb, from conception to birth, marked by rapid growth and organ formation.
Trimesters
The three periods of approximately three months each into which pregnancy is divided, marking different phases of fetal development.
